Cybersecurity Basics Glossary

Photographer: Markus Spiske | Source: Unsplash Cybersecurity is the practice of protecting electronic information by mitigating information risks and vulnerabilities. It involves the use of security tools, policies, and procedures to protect against unauthorized access, use, disclosure, alteration, or destruction of data. Cybersecurity is important for businesses, governments, and individuals to protect their electronic information from cyber threats. Here are some terms to help you know more about the terminology used in the cybersecurity realm. What is a cyberattack? A cyberattack is a malicious act that is carried out remotely, often through the use of a computer network. The purpose of a cyberattack can be to steal information, sabotage systems, or simply cause disruption. Hackers are the most common perpetrators of cyberattacks, but they can also be carried out by criminals, nation-states, or activists. What is a cybercriminal?
